FARMINGDALE, N.Y. (CBSNewYork) – A special honor was given on Long Island in memory of an FDNY firefighter who died of cancer after working at Ground Zero in the days following the September 11 terror attacks.
The corner of Rita Place and Crestwood Boulevard in Farmingdale has been renamed as FDNY Captain John S. Moschella Way.
Moschella died last December after a fight with colorectal cancer.
